Mathea Morais is the author of the children’s book: <i>I’m Lucy: A Day in the Life of a Young Bonobo</i> that features an afterword by renowned primatologist Jane Goodall. Mathea also runs the Martha’s Vineyard Public Charter School’s High School Writing Lab and has taught creative writing for more than 10 years on Martha’s Vineyard and in Boston. Mathea's freelance work has been published in online and print magazines such as Trace Magazine and Inshop.com. She has a BA in English from New York University. Mathea lives in Chilmark with her three daughters and husband, painter Chioke R. Morais.
